Result Ring 0 Base Address Register
This register is the result ring 0 base address in host memory. After the 820x finishes a
command, it will write the result to the result ring. The Result Ring (RR) base address must
be 8-byte aligned.

Result Ring 0 Write Pointer Register
This register is the 820x result ring 0 write pointer. The host can read this register to
determine the how many entries the 820x has written to the result ring 0.
